Disa's Plot is a Quest in Dragon's Dogma 2 (DD2). Captain Brant has shed some light on Disa's misdemeanor, he asks you, the Arisen, to infiltrate the palace to gather enough evidence to uncover the queen's secrets. This quest requires the player to head to the rear gate of the castle between the hours of midnight and dawn. This quest requires the passage of time and has no multiple outcomes.

Disa's Plot Dragon's Dogma 2 Quest Details
How to Unlock Disa's Plot in Dragon's Dogma 2
The Disa's Plot quest can be unlocked if you choose "Accept" to the dialogue line "Tell me of the queen regent." when speaking to Brant at The Stardrop Inn of Vernworth during the quest "Seat of the Sovran".

Disa's Plot Dragon's Dogma 2 Quest Walkthrough
Searching for Evidence
To recap, this quest is unlocked by choosing "Accept" to the dialogue option "Tell me of the queen regent." when speaking to Brant at the Stardrop Inn during the quest, Seat of the Sovran. This quest requires the player to head to the rear gate of the castle between the hours of midnight and dawn. When you arrive, one of Brant's guards will identify you and ask that you follow. Keep close to the NPC until you reach The Guardhouse. [See Dragon's Dogma 2 Map]
Before you start to snoop around for evidence, keep in mind that you are within a restricted area, so try not to get caught or the guards will be forced to attack and capture you. Inside The Guardhouse, there is a chest containing x1 Marcher's Helm, x1 Marcher's Armor, and x1 Marcher's Cuisses. You'll also find a few items in this room.
NOTE: BEFORE HEADING INSIDE THE CASTLE, UNEQUIP YOUR CURRENT ARMOR AND WEAR THE MARCHER'S SET THAT YOU JUST GOT FROM THE CHEST IN THE GUARDHOUSE. WEARING THIS WHILE YOU'RE WITHIN CASTLE GROUNDS (ESPECIALLY AT NIGHT) DISGUISES YOURSELF, ALLOWING YOUR CHARACTER TO WALK AROUND FREELY.
Go inside the next room then make a left to find x1 Lantern Oil on a dressing table. Go back to where you came in and you'll see a set of stairs in front of the doorway. Near the stairs, you'll find another dressing table that has a small tapestry pinned to the wall. On the dressing table, you can find a note "Writings of a Soldier on Duty".
Now your destination is the Vernworth Castle Offices which is on the second floor of the castle. Go to the main hall but proceed carefully as guards are roaming the main hall. You can find the spiral stairs by going to the main hall, go right, and then straight. There's a doorway to the right where you'll find the spiral stairs. Again, be careful not to get caught as another guard is roaming the stairs. On the second floor, turn left and you'll see a room to the left, this is the Vernworth Castle - Guest Chambers. Go inside this room to find a chest containing x1 Courtly Tunic and x1 Courtly Breeches.
Go back and continue down the hallway and you'll find the next room, also on the left, which is the Vernworth Castle Offices. Go inside and check the desk at the end of the room to find a "Torn Letter", pick it up and a dialogue cutscene will trigger showing Sven who catches you in the room. In this scene, you'll find out that he is the son of Disa and is happy to know that what you are plotting contributes to revealing his mother's wrongful schemes. After speaking to Sven, make your escape by climbing out of the window of the office. Carefully slide down the roof and jump back down to the entrance of The Guardhouse.
Report Back to Brant
For the next objective, report back to Brant at The Stardrop Inn at night and choose "Tell e of the queen regent" when you speak to him. Give him the Torn Letter to progress and complete the quest. Completing the quest rewards the player with x1 Wakestone, 6500 G, and 1200 XP.
Disa's Plot Dragon's Dogma 2 Trivia, Notes and Tips
- Unlocking this quest requires reaching Melve and progress the main quest: Seat of the Sovran
- There is a chest in the Vernworth Royal Chambers of the castle. The chest contains x1 Wakestone and x1 Wakestone Shard.
- There is a chest at the Castle Training Ground, outside the castle, and near The Guardhouse. The chest contains x1 Iron Shield.
- There is a chest in the Vernworth Castle - Guest Chambers of the castle. The chest contains x1 Courtly Tunic and x1 Courtly Breeches.
- There is a chest in The Guardhouse of the castle. The chest contains x1 Marcher's Helm, x1 Marcher's Armor, and x1 Marcher's Cuisses.
- This quest has no multiple outcomes.
